Stephen Schneider Dead: Stanford Climatologist And Nobel Peace Prize Winner Dies At 65

Stephen Schneider, a Stanford University scientist who served on the international research panel on global warming that shared the 2007 Nobel Prize with former Vice President Al Gore, has died. He was 65.

Schneider died of an apparent heart attack Monday while on a flight from Stockholm to London, Stanford officials said.

Schneider studied climate change for decades and wrote a number of books charting its effects on wildlife and ecosystems in the United States, and later chronicled its effect on the nation's politics and policy. He advised every presidential administration from Nixon to Obama.
